Ideas for improving the Draft mode.
- Introduce a leaderboard. Ideally, add season-end rewards. At the moment, I play this mode for not the most positive reasons:
- The ladder doesn't seem like a place where skill truly decides the outcome, even over the long run;
- The ladder can get too monotonous;
- Here, I level up my experience much faster and more efficiently, since my win rate stays consistently around 60–65%.
- But I would like to have positive goals for playing this mode...
- Add card rerolls and/or a full deck rebuild to mitigate the impact of RNG in card selection.
- This could be localized — sometimes you get drops where you're offered 3 options of 3–4 cards each, and none of them are useful to anyone in their right mind. A solution: give, for example, 3 rerolls per draft.
- Alongside this, you could add the option to fully rebuild your deck after the draft ends — for example, for 50–100 gold. Sometimes you already know in advance: this is going to be 0–3, no way around it. Sure, you don't want to just give up, but losing 3 times in a row with no chance isn't exactly uplifting either.
